## Activities

**Activities:** Hackney Youth Orchestras Trust is a music school for children and young people living or studying in Hackney and neighbouring boroughs. The School&#x27;s progressive concessions policy makes it accessible to groups currently under-represented in music education. Students are taught by professional musicians both individually and in groups, leading to regular free public concert performances.
